First published in 1982, this collection of essays provides an
analysis of education's contradictory role in social reproduction.
It looks at the complex relations between the economic, political
and cultural spheres of society, both historically and at the time
of publication, and hones the wider range of debate in on
education. This volume will be of interest to those studying
sociology and equality in education.
